For the record, I had an issue with my 1997 Chevrolet Venture van where the cruise stopped working, It turned out to be a burned out "board" which is the housing in the rear of the van that contains the bulbs for the stop lamps and taillights. Water gets in and corrodes the contacts and causes a host of problems. This is a known issue with these vans and when someone reports their cruise stops working suddenly, they are told to check their rear lights. This goes to show how certain systems' issues can affect others and can help in diagnosing the problem. (Issue with rear lights = possible issue with cruise control) Years ago I remember if your rear taillights weren't working, then you had no dash lights, kind of a "safety warning notification".
